Atiqput : Inuit Oral History and Project Naming Blackfoot Language Oren Lyons has several contributionsEdited by Carol Payne, Beth Greenhorn, Deborah Kigjugalik Webster and Christina Williamson with a foreword by Jimmy Manning. A multigenerational discussion of culture, history, and naming centring on archival photographs of Inuit whose names were previously unrecorded."Our names Atiqput are very meaningful. They are our identification. They are our Spirits. We are named after what's in the sky for strength, whats in the water the land, body parts.
